While JPG is a highly efficient format for sharing and storing digital photographs, there are scenarios where raw, uncompressed image data is preferred—especially in programming, image analysis, and hardware-level rendering. This is where the PPM format becomes useful. PPM (Portable Pixmap) is a simple, uncompressed format designed for portability and ease of parsing. Converting JPG to PPM is ideal for developers and researchers who require precise control over pixel data without the interference of compression artifacts. This article covers the key differences between JPG and PPM, the motivations behind converting, and how to execute the conversion using various tools and techniques.
JPG (or JPEG) stands for Joint Photographic Experts Group. It is a compressed image format that uses lossy compression to significantly reduce file size while maintaining acceptable visual quality. JPG is widely used for photos and web images where storage and speed are crucial.
PPM (Portable Pixmap Format) is part of the Netpbm format family (which includes PBM and PGM). It is a plain-text or binary format used to store uncompressed RGB images with minimal overhead. PPM is simple enough to be read and parsed by hand or with basic code, making it valuable for low-level image manipulation.

There are multiple ways to convert a JPG file to a PPM format using command-line tools, software applications, or programming libraries:
ImageMagick is a powerful and widely-used tool for image conversion and processing:
convert input.jpg output.ppm
Or with specific options for resizing or color adjustment:
convert input.jpg -resize 800x600 -colorspace RGB output.ppm
If you're on a Unix or Linux system, Netpbm tools can directly convert JPG to PPM:
jpegtopnm input.jpg > output.ppm
This command reads a JPG and writes the PPM version using Netpbm's standards.
Python’s Pillow library makes image conversion straightforward in code:
from PIL import Image img = Image.open("input.jpg") img.save("output.ppm")
Perfect for scripting batch conversions or integrating into larger applications.
PPM files come in two flavors: plain-text (P3) and binary (P6). While both store RGB data, the binary format is more space-efficient and faster to read/write.
